  3. Feedstock-To-Tailpipe Analysis of Soybean-Derived Biodiesel and Glycerol Valorization in Kansas

    Biodiesel has become a popular substitute to ultra-low sulfur diesel due to its production from renewable or waste feedstocks and direct use in compression-ignition engines. Biodiesel is currently fabricated via oil transesterification which also produces crude glycerol as a byproduct. The crude …
